Bionic legs approved for UK sale

A set of 'bionic legs' for people who have difficulties walking has been approved for sale in the UK.

Rex bionic legs were designed by two Scottish school friends.

The legs are one of a handful of 'exoskeletons' which could offer more independence for people with spinal injuries or mobility problems.

Elena Bertoldo has flown over from Italy to be fitted with the device for the first time.
